Cursed Beehives are an enemy in Banjo-Tooie.

Characteristics[edit]

Cursed Beehives resemble regular beehives, but then attack Banjo and Kazooie once they get close. Despite that, they are as strong as their harmless counterparts and can be defeated by moves such as the Rat-a-tat Rap. Unlike them, however, Cursed Beehives have a chance to drop Skill Stop and Random Stop Honeycombs if they are destroyed by using Ice Eggs then breathing fire with Dragon Kazooie.
